Complete Tax Breakdown

Detailed line-by-line tax calculation for a Telephone Operators earning $34,640 in Pennsylvania (single filer, standard deduction).

Tax Component Annual Amount Effective Rate
Gross Salary (Median) $34,640
Federal Income Tax -$2,172 6.3%
Pennsylvania State Income Tax -$1,063 3.1%
Social Security (OASDI) -$2,147 6.2%
Medicare -$502 1.4%
Total Taxes -$5,886 17.0%
Take-Home Pay $28,753 83.0%

How is Telephone Operators take-home pay in Pennsylvania calculated?

We start with the 2024 BLS median salary of $34,640 for Telephone Operators in Pennsylvania, then subtract: federal income tax using 2024 IRS brackets ($14,600 standard deduction), Pennsylvania state income tax (3.1% flat rate), Social Security (6.2% up to $168,600), and Medicare (1.45%). The result — $28,753/yr — does not include local taxes, pre-tax deductions (401k, HSA), or tax credits.

Tax Calculation Assumptions

This estimate assumes a single filer using the 2024 standard deduction ($14,600), with W-2 employment income only. It does not account for: itemized deductions, tax credits (e.g. earned income credit, child tax credit), local/city taxes, pre-tax contributions (401k, HSA, FSA), self-employment tax, or additional income sources.
